ijust changed from norton 04 to the anti spyware 2005 and am having trouble
getting an internet connection, getting on sites, page cannot be displayed
will come up. If I turn off the norton firewall it works no problem. Is there
something I am missing? Any suggestions greatly appreciated.I have xp sp2
When I try to turn off windows firewall , it still says it is on.

Hello hopeful.

I had the same issue when the last time I tested Norton IS 2005 (Antispyware
ed.)
This happened because Norton IS 2005 has integrated Personal Firewall which
is very nasty in my opinion and also difficult to control.Your problem
because because Norton's firewall blocked Internet Explorer (iexplorer.exe)
and some other files essential for internet.

So the only decision I would suggest is to contact Symantec and change to
Norton ANTIVIRUS 2006 (not Internet Security,only Antivirus)

So while installing the new 2006 Antivirus ,you will be able to keep your
Windows Firewall ON and turn OFF Norton AV's worm protection so you will have
no problems.

In which case I'd (1) uninstall NIS 2005/2006, (2) uninstall Norton Whatever
2004 via Add/Remove Programs, (3) run all the removal tools appropriate for
Norton Whatever 2004 listed here...

Symantec NAV, NIS, NSW Removal
http://basconotw.mvps.org/SymRem.htm

...and then (4) reinstall NIS 2005/2006.

If still no joy, see
http://service1.symantec.com/Support/nip.nsf/docid/2005083015103436: Perform
all steps from "To disable Symantec Protection in the 2006 product" down.
